Below Deck Mediterranean Star Joao Franco Explains Why His Dream Crew Includes Everyone This Season Minus Hannah Ferrier

It’s the question that gets posed time and time again to the cast of Below Deck and Below Deck Mediterranean.  Who’s on your yachtie dream-team?  For this season, the Med crew was pretty solid after microwave operator Mila Kolomeitseva left.  Anastasia Surmava did an admiral job as chef until she stepped aside for Ben Robinson to saunter back into our livesJune Foster only made a favorable impression on smitten Colin Macy O-Toole, but her tenure was also short-lived.

So we are finishing the season with the original squad, plus an actual chef.  Captain Sandy Yawn has been dishing out the hugs in proper mother hen fashion.  What can be better than that?  Well, according to Bosun Joao Franco, there is one person that could improve at their job.

Joao and Ben appeared on the Watch What Happens Live Aftershow this week and both guys gave their responses.  When asked to build his Below Deck dream team, Ben said, “I really liked the first season of Below Deck original, and I really liked the first season of the Med.  So it would be an amalgamation of the two.”

Ben wasn’t more specific but perhaps one can speculate who he would pick.  Definitely Eddie Lucas as Bosun.  The only memorable deckhand from either season was David Bradberry Kate Chastain wasn’t on board in Season 1 of Below Deck, so maybe Ben would pick Hannah Ferrier as Chief Stew.  Maybe to round out the interior he would include Tiffany Copeland and Kat Held.  He’s hooked up with both of those ladies, after all.

Joao’s answer was more specific, and certainly more direct.  And considering how well Joao handled himself this season, both professionally and personally, his opinion definitely carries more weight.

Joao responded, “I think completely this season except [for] Hannah.  I think as a Chief Stew, work-related only, there’s a lot more that can be done.  That’s my personal opinion.”

Ouch.  But completely warranted.  Though Hannah cut out the cigarette breaks, her work ethic really leaves much to be desired.  She’ll do the basic minimum, but never strives to better herself.  Like when Captain Sandy asked her to update the table arrangements and Hannah couldn’t be bothered to leave her bunk to go shopping for items.

Luckily for Hannah, it seems the charter guests haven’t been asking for too many themed parties or beach picnics this year.
